In February 1968, the small town of Gaffney, South Carolina, was plunged into darkness. Over eight terrifying days, a serial killer known as the Gaffney Strangler claimed the lives of three women, taunted the local newspaper, and left a community barricaded in their homes.This is the story of how a cryptic phone call to a newspaper editor led police to two bodies, exposed a wrongful conviction, and sparked one of the largest manhunts in the county’s history.
